WebTasting notes are the unique natural flavour elements that coffee beans have. the best way to describe it would be like different variations of Apples. You can have the sharpness of A granny smith and the super sweetness of a pink lady; both are still apples with nothing added, but they have two completely different flavours.

WebSometimes, tasting notes are obvious, like smokiness in a very darkly roasted coffee. Other times, the flavors are more subtle. The Guji coffee zone was created in 2002 and named after a Oromia tribe. Coffee from the Guji zone presents a distinctive terroir that sets it apart from the larger Oromia region. Flavor notes include dark chocolate, floral, and sweetly tart acidity. 4.
